Transaction 72667338c0b16b5a4a5cb031aeabf2357d69027da2540a0b8e897d3df103836c
1 Input
1 Output
-
72667338c0b16b5a4a5cb031aeabf2357d69027da2540a0b8e897d3df103836c:0
- value
- 18987
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f7fd87ca59c46e2b7bd22607452b6bf296488130 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PcFcz9aQ8E8GrzxiZy2kuiPMJJoLQ2K1A